Well the #8 is an Action but the #3 is Revell. Action is by far the best out there. I went last week looking at stores and hobby shops for more die-cast and it didn't take me long at all to appreciate just how good Action is. The paint and details are just plain horrid on everything else. Frankly I am suprised now at how OK the Revell is compared to everything else out there :rolleyes:

Thanks for the compliments guys. Simple set-up really. Piece of glass over black poster board. 2 27" softboxes and some reflectors. f/25 1/200.
